41 // Hash function implementation for the nontrivial specialization.
42 // All of them are based on a primitive that hashes a pointer to a
43 // byte array. The actual hash algorithm is not guaranteed to stay
44 // the same from release to release -- it may be updated or tuned to
45 // improve hash quality or speed.
46 size_t
47 _Hash_bytes(const void* __ptr, size_t __len, size_t __seed);
49 // A similar hash primitive, using the FNV hash algorithm. This
50 // algorithm is guaranteed to stay the same from release to release.
51 // (although it might not produce the same values on different
52 // machines.)
53 size_t
54 _Fnv_hash_bytes(const void* __ptr, size_t __len, size_t __seed);
